For Fsinn there will be two installers. From there you will have to install in the order it forces you, one won't install if the other isn't. And then you will have to enter your vatsim login and password they gave you.

 

You will also need to pick your server you want to use, most click the one closest to home, though I choose west coast cause I always have issues with the east coast.

The errors you have are very common in FSINN, you need to go to the vatsim FSINN forum, there is a sticky in there.

Install verbatum, do not take any liberties or you will get errors.

 

Once installed, follow the troubleshooting link and you should be up and running.
